How Vaccinations Work

Think of vaccinations as a training ground for your body. They introduce a weakened or inactive version of the disease into your system. Your body, recognizing these invaders, learns to fight them off. If the real disease ever shows up, your body is prepared. It knows how to defeat it. That’s the beauty of vaccinations.

What Does an Orthopedic Surgeon Do?

Orthopedic surgeons are the unsung heroes of the medical field. They treat conditions in the musculoskeletal system which includes bones, joints, ligaments, tendons, muscles, and nerves. They help you get back on your feet, literally and figuratively.
